    I have this tiny pitcher, 4 " tall, 4.5 " from tip of spout to widest part of handle. I absolutely love the unusual shape, but the bottom is so small it could not hold very much liquid, so maybe it's a vase? It looks very delicate, but actually weighs 9 oz. It has a clear, applied handle and a rough pontil on the bottom. I would call it amber glass. Here is my question: When I search "amber glass" it almost always shows crackle glass. (Mine is not crackle glass, but more ridged.) Does that mean this is not a vintage piece? What is the connection between amber glass and crackle glass? Thank you for any help!
